The main causes of night sweats
- Too high a room temperatureThe most obvious cause: a room that is too warm or blankets that are too thick. During sleep, the body regulates its temperature, and if it is too hot, it sweats to cool down.
Simple solution: choose cotton sheets, avoid synthetic materials and air your room well before going to sleep.
